    Synopsis

    The donut seller has a round belly. "How did you get pregnant?" asks someone. The girl smiles shyly: "You don't get enough money selling donuts." A boy gets a child's plaster stuck on head at a Catholic hospital. The wound is the result of a vicious attack. Another boy, who has a bad rash, has to swallow his pills on the spot, to make sure he doesn't go and sell them. ROAMING AROUND portrays migrated children struggling to survive in the Ghanaian capital. They have problems with their parents or lost one of them. The camera captures their impressing faces of innocence, desperation, suffering and beauty. Their choice for the street is an escape into a life without fear. But there is no easy way back.This is a strong, sincere and emotionally charged film about childhood not to be missed.

    Festivals

    Awards: German Short Film Award in Gold, Best Cinematography, Best Editing, One World Price, Doc-polis Award
    Barcelona, Nomination for the Human Rights Award Germany, Nomination for the Golden Key Kassel
    Festivals: Amsterdam, Barcelona, Beirut, Cologne, Dresden, Frankfurt, Kampala, Kassel, Neubrandenburg/Szczecin,
    Osnabrueck, Toronto, Wiesbaden
